About CAROLYN G BUKHAIR EL

CAROLYN G BUKHAIR EL is a middle-of-the-pack elementary school in DALLAS, Texas, run under RICHARDSON ISD. The school caters to 694 students in grades pre-K through 6. That puts it 34% bigger than the typical public school in Texas, which averages around 519 students.

Within RICHARDSON ISD, which oversees 55 schools and 38,526 students, CAROLYN G BUKHAIR EL is one campus in the system.

On demographics, CAROLYN G BUKHAIR EL shows that 92% of students identify as Hispanic, making the school strongly Hispanic-majority. Beyond that, the school reports 5% Black. By comparison, Dallas County as a whole is about 41% Hispanic, so the school skews considerably more Hispanic than its surroundings.

On the resource side, The school reports having 45 full-time-equivalent teachers, for a student-teacher ratio near 15.6:1. That tracks the state average closely. An estimated 93% of students are eligible for free or reduced-price lunch, a number frequently used as a low-income enrollment indicator. That share is noticeably above Dallas County's rate of about 77%.

After controlling for student poverty, CAROLYN G BUKHAIR EL sits in the middle band of the BeatsExpectations distribution. Schools with this campus's student mix typically land near 33.4%; this one delivers 31.8%.

In the broader community, community-level numbers for Dallas County indicate median household earnings sit near $76,547, about 36%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 11%. Across Dallas County's 771 public schools (combined enrollment of about 459,645 students), CAROLYN G BUKHAIR EL is one campus in the mix.

DOBIE PRE-KINDERGARTEN SCHOOL is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.3 miles from this campus. 8 of the 8 nearest public schools sit inside a five-mile radius. Among the 7 schools in that immediate cluster with test data (this one included), CAROLYN G BUKHAIR EL ranks 4th on composite proficiency, behind the local average of 38.1%.

The school occupies a metropolitan site.

Five-year trend. CAROLYN G BUKHAIR EL's enrollment has rose 4% since 2018, when it stood at 665 (now 694). Hispanic enrollment moved from 83% to 92% across the same window.
